Here is a 2022 experience with The Composites Store that is similar to another reviewer's in 2018. My small order of $28 somehow got a $41 shipping charge (initially indicated as $15). Had they asked me about a $26 increase in shipping, I'd have cancelled the order.The company is not clear exactly what shipping charges will be. (My small order was split into two mailings, each Priority Mail 2, but I gave no indication of any hurry.) My guess is they cater mostly to industrial customers who order more and want it fast.

I will never buy anything from this company again. They did not tell me what they were charging me for shipping until after they sent my order. They charged me $60.78 to ship my order FedEx from Tehachapi, CA to Modesto, CA! I ordered the exact same product plus a few more items from Jamestown Distributors in Warwick, RI and they only charged me $32.57 for shipping. I went with CST because they were local, even though they cost $29.96 more than Jamestown Distributors for the same product. I wanted to support a local company and assumed that there shipping would be a little less than JD which would offset some of the extra cost. I do blame myself for not researching their shipping cost beforehand. Just to top it off though, when I called to see if they would be willing to make an adjustment to what they charged me in shipping, the person said that they technically should have charged me an extra $5. She encouraged me to make my purchases through Jamestown Distributors in the future, I will definitely take that advice!
